How to Install a Wall Electric Fireplace

The ideal wall-mounted electric fireplace can be either installed or recessed in order to save space and create a recessed look. Some are even hard-wired to your home's electrical system.

wall-mounted-electric-fireplace-stainless-steel-fireplace-decor-for-the-living-room-or-bedroom-with-2-heat-settings-and-remote-control-by-northwest-15.jpgMany models are also portable, making them easy to move if you change the look of your home. They can also be connected to conventional outlets.

Features

A wall-mounted electric fireplace is a fantastic way to provide warmth and comfort to any room. It is a popular choice for rooms where wood-burning fires wall mounted are not possible, such as bedrooms and offices. It is also an excellent choice for a living or family room as it can be used to add an accent that is both fashionable and functional.

There are many different types of wall hung electric fires that are available. When selecting one, it is essential to take into account several factors. These include size, heat output, and style. The size of the fire is crucial because it determines how much space it will take up on your wall and how it fits in with the overall design of your home. The amount of heat produced will determine the degree of warmth your home will feel once the fire is going.

Style and finish are also important aspects to consider when choosing an electric fireplace that is wall-mounted. There are many different finishes available for these fireplaces, from black and white to metallic silver and even wood veneer. It is essential to select a style that will compliment the rest of your decor and match the colour scheme of your room.

The type of heater is an additional feature to be looking for when buying a wall-mounted electric fireplace. The majority of these fireplaces use fan-forced heating systems. This means that a blower circulates air over the heating element in order to provide warmth to the room. They are generally efficient and can be controlled by the touch screen or remote control, or a thermostat.

Certain models of wall-hung electric fireplaces also come with an LCD display that displays the current settings of the unit. This can be helpful in case you aren't certain how to operate the fireplace or if it's malfunctioning. In addition, these fireplaces are often equipped with an automatic overheat protection system that shuts the fireplace off when it gets too hot.

A different option to the traditional wall-mounted electric fireplace is the electric inset fire. These fireplaces can be installed into the wall or recessing to make them less noticeable. They can be a perfect choice for those who are seeking to add a modern style to their home or apartment without the hassle of installation.

Installation

When you're planning to install a wall electric fireplace, there are a number of things to be considered. First, you'll need to decide if you'd like the fireplace to be recessed or mounted. The choice is based on the style you're looking for. A recessed model requires you to frame out space in the wall, while a mounted electric fire can simply sit on the wall in a straight line for an elegant look.

When selecting a location for your new wall mounted electric fire it's an excellent idea to make sure that the location you choose is close enough to an electrical outlet for the fire's power cable to reach. It may be beneficial to move the plug socket closer to the fireplace to create a more streamlined look and to avoid any unsightly cable showing.

It's time to gather the tools. If you have the right tools, installing a wall-mounted fire is easy and can be done in just 30 minutes. A spirit level is essential as it will ensure that the mounting bracket is properly positioned against the wall fires. You will also require a screwdriver as well as the drill. A ladder or scaffolding is required to reach the hard-to-reach areas of the room.

You'll then need to measure the height and width of the wall mounting area the wall fitted electric fires to determine the size of the fireplace frame you will require. You can buy a fireplace wall kit that comes with everything you need to build the frame. You can also use blocks to construct an individual wall to house the fireplace.

Before you begin drilling into the wall it's a good idea to test your fireplace to make sure it's functioning properly. Before beginning the installation plug it in and test out the heat and lights. After the framing is completed, you can attach the fireplace to the mounting brackets and hang the glass front.

Safety

Electric fireplaces provide the ambience of a traditional fire without the added hazards of real flames and sparks. It is still essential to take safety precautions when using these types of heaters in your home. Keep all objects, including fingers, a safe distance from the flame and ensure that you keep the fireplace well-ventilated so it doesn't get too hot. Also, be sure to disconnect the unit when it is not being used.

In contrast to wood-burning or gas-burning fireplaces, which create real flames that are hazardous to contact, an electric fire is only made up of LED lights, video images or mist. This means it doesn't create the extreme heat which can cause warping of a metal or wood mantel ledge, or ignite flames that can ignite flammable wall coverings, fabrics and furnishings. This is one of the main reasons people choose electric fireplaces over their traditional counterparts.

However, the heat delivered by a wall electric fireplace is emitted from the front of the device and can be warm to the touch. It is essential to think about the location of the heating vents on the in-wall fireplace electric prior to buying it. It is recommended to have an area of 3 feet between the heating vent of the fireplace and any furniture or walls within your house.

It is also crucial to note that not all electric fireplaces offer the same amount of heat. Be sure to check the BTU's of each model prior to making a final purchase. The more powerful the BTU number, the greater heat will be generated in the space.

Be sure to check out the safety features of a wall-mounted electric fireplace. Make sure you select a model with CSA certification for electrical safety, an automatic shutoff, and thermal overload protection. This will reduce the risk of an electrical short-circuit or fire hazard.

It is also important to check the fireplace regularly for signs of wear and tear. In addition, make sure that the fireplace is free of combustible materials and don't place any furniture or drapes over it. Make sure it isn't connected to a power source that is sharing space with other equipment and appliances to ensure that the outlet is not overloaded.

Style

Electric fireplaces mounted on walls are stylish and can add ambiance to any space regardless of whether it's a home, condo or commercial space. The majority of models have a stunning bed of glowing embers and an authentic flame effect that can be utilized with or without heat. These units can be put over existing furniture like a console or sofa. Plugging them into a standard outlet makes it easy to use and operate.

The majority of models are available in a variety of sizes to be able to fit into different spaces. Some models can be mounted in a flush position against the wall, while others are recessed or completely into the wall, giving it a more integrated appearance. Some electric fireplaces can be mounted on an overhang, making it a more traditional-looking unit.

Installation of these models might require more work as they need to be constructed around or cut into the existing structure in your home. They will however give a more finished, professional appearance than a single wall-mounted unit.

If you're seeking a more flexible solution, top venting fireplaces are a great choice. These units have an integrated vent to let heated air circulate at the top, which allows the air to be distributed throughout the room. They are also simpler to install as they can be hung directly on a frame of 2x6 wall, instead of being recessed.
